The Complete Guide to Building a “Learning Flywheel”

Photo continuous learning

The concept of a learning flywheel is rooted in the idea of creating a self-reinforcing cycle of knowledge acquisition and application. Much like a physical flywheel, which requires an initial investment of energy to start spinning but then continues to gain momentum with minimal effort, a learning flywheel operates on the principle that once you establish a rhythm of learning, it becomes easier to maintain and accelerate. This model emphasizes the interconnectedness of various learning experiences, where each new piece of knowledge or skill builds upon previous ones, creating a compounding effect that enhances overall understanding and capability.

In practical terms, a learning flywheel can be visualized as a continuous loop where learning leads to application, which in turn generates feedback that informs further learning. For instance, an individual might learn a new programming language, apply it in a project, receive feedback from peers or mentors, and then seek out additional resources to deepen their understanding. This cycle not only fosters a deeper grasp of the subject matter but also encourages the learner to explore adjacent areas, thereby broadening their skill set and enhancing their adaptability in an ever-evolving landscape.

Skill Stacking: Building on Your Existing Knowledge

continuous learning

Skill stacking refers to the practice of combining multiple skills to create a unique value proposition. This approach recognizes that while mastering a single skill can be beneficial, the real power lies in the intersection of various competencies. For example, a professional who possesses both technical skills in data analysis and strong communication abilities can effectively translate complex data insights into actionable strategies for stakeholders.

This combination makes them more valuable than someone who excels in only one area. Building on existing knowledge through skill stacking allows individuals to differentiate themselves in the job market. By identifying complementary skills that enhance their primary expertise, learners can create a more robust professional profile.

For instance, a marketer who understands basic coding can collaborate more effectively with developers, leading to more cohesive project outcomes. This strategic approach not only enhances employability but also opens up new avenues for career advancement and innovation.

Creating a Personalized Learning Plan

A personalized learning plan is essential for maximizing the effectiveness of one’s educational journey. Such a plan should begin with a self-assessment to identify strengths, weaknesses, interests, and career goals. By understanding where they currently stand and where they want to go, learners can tailor their educational experiences to align with their aspirations.

This targeted approach ensures that time and resources are invested in areas that will yield the greatest return on investment. Once the self-assessment is complete, learners should outline specific objectives and milestones within their personalized learning plan. These goals should be SMART—Specific, Measurable, Achievable, Relevant, and Time-bound—to facilitate tracking progress and maintaining motivation.

For example, if an individual aims to improve their public speaking skills, they might set a goal to deliver three presentations within six months while seeking feedback from peers after each session. This structured approach not only provides clarity but also fosters accountability, making it easier to stay committed to the learning process.

Overcoming Barriers to Continuous Learning

Despite the clear benefits of continuous learning, many individuals encounter barriers that hinder their progress. Time constraints are often cited as one of the most significant obstacles; busy schedules filled with work and personal commitments can make it challenging to prioritize education. To combat this issue, learners must adopt effective time management strategies that allow them to carve out dedicated periods for study or skill development.

Techniques such as the Pomodoro Technique or time blocking can help maximize productivity during these sessions. Another common barrier is the fear of failure or inadequacy that can accompany new learning experiences. Many individuals hesitate to pursue new skills due to concerns about not being good enough or making mistakes along the way.

It is crucial to reframe this mindset by recognizing that failure is an integral part of the learning process. Embracing a culture of experimentation encourages learners to take risks and view setbacks as opportunities for growth rather than reasons to abandon their pursuits.

Leveraging Feedback and Reflection for Growth

Feedback is an invaluable component of the learning process that can significantly enhance personal development. Actively seeking feedback from peers, mentors, or instructors provides insights into areas for improvement and reinforces strengths. Constructive criticism can illuminate blind spots that learners may not recognize on their own, allowing them to make informed adjustments to their approach or understanding.

Reflection is equally important in this context; taking time to contemplate what has been learned and how it applies to real-world situations fosters deeper comprehension. Journaling or engaging in discussions about recent experiences can help solidify knowledge and identify patterns or themes that emerge over time. By integrating feedback and reflection into their learning flywheel, individuals create a robust mechanism for continuous improvement that propels them forward in their educational journey.
